Blanch, NC - It is with profound sorrow we announce the death of Mr. Lonnie Johnson of 964 County Home Rd. Blanch, NC, who passed away Saturday, October 30, 2021 in the Bon Secours St. Mary's Hospital Richmond, Virginia.
Mr. Lonnie Leon Johnson was born July 13, 1938 in Caswell County, NC to the late Louis H. Johnson and Lemma Fuller Johnson. He was a member of the Blackwell Missionary Baptist Church, Yanceyville, NC where he served as an Usher.
Mr. Lonnie Leon Johnson was a veteran of the United States Army and a retiree of the Dairy Department of Giant Foods Company. He was a member of the High Rock Hunting Club and the Corvette Club.
In addition to his parents, Mr. Lonnie Leon Johnson was preceded in death by five brothers, James Johnson, Herman Johnson, Joe Lewis Johnson, Rufus Johnson and David Johnson; five sisters, Queen J. Wilson, Annie J. Lea, Mary J. Bigelow, Helen J. Florence and Julia J. Foster.
Mr. Lonnie Leon Johnson leaves to cherish his memories his beloved wife, Wynolia Jeffries Johnson of the residence; two daughters, Debra Coleman-Mitchell of Temple Hills, MD; Cherrill Covington of Brandywine, MD; two brothers, Otis Johnson (Shirley) of Blanch, NC and Otha Johnson (Yvonne) of Maryland; six sisters-in-law, Emma Johnson, Virginia Johnson, Elizabeth A. Jeffries, Hazel Jeffries, Joan Jeffries, and Sylvia Lou Jeffries; three brothers-in-law, Ackery Foster, Thadas Jeffries (Francina) and Theodore Jeffries; six grandchildren, Charis Johnson, Tinesha Mitchell-Lightfoot, Michelle Littlejohn, Cedrica Mitchell, James Mitchell and Angel Laverne Mitchell; three great- grandchildren, Landon Lightfoot, Elijah Lightfoot, Carter Lightfoot and a host of nieces, nephews, other relatives, and friends.
